You complete an exercise, but you do not get a Thanks! page. Nothing at all happens. Cause: One or more of your questions does not have the correct answer checked. Solution: Using the Back Button (which looks like this: <==), page back through each item, verifying that the correct answer has been checked. You complete an exercise, but, instead of getting a Thanks! page, you get a window that says something like "URL Not Found." Cause: That usually means the server is temporarily busy. Perhaps someone else submitted a quiz at the exact instant you did. Solution: Wait a couple of seconds, then click your last correct answer ONCE more. Don't make extra clicks. The Thanks! page should appear shortly.
